Because familiar smells will
make the
cat feel safer, it is as bad to remove all scent sources —
bedding, toys, scratching surfaces — from their shelter housing as it is to give them nowhere to hide.
If that's the case, the understandable next step — changing the
bedding to remove all traces of urine and feces — may
make the problem worse, not better, by removing the very scents the
cat was trying to use to reduce his or her anxiety.
